At 2:00 pm (Brasília time) on Friday (15), the Dow Jones Industrial Average was down 0.40% and traded at 30,862 points. US President-elect Joe Biden announced yesterday (14) that he will roll out the $ 1.9 trillion package of economic stimulus to the country as soon as he takes office on January 20. The news was felt in a negative way by investors who fear an increase in the country's taxes to cover expenses. In addition, North American retail sales fell 0.7% in December amid social containment measures against the coronavirus. JP Morgan Chase & Co's shares fell 1.76%, Citigroup Inc, -6.86% and Wells Fargo & Co, -6.13%.
